On March 1, 2025, the latest adaptation of Alexandre Dumas' iconic novel 'The Count of Monte Cristo' will premiere on the PBS app and PBS Masterpiece on Prime Video. Directed by Oscar-winning filmmaker Bille August, the series stars Sam Claflin as Edmond Dantès, a young sailor who was falsely accused of treason and imprisoned without trial in the Château d'If, a grim island fortress off the coast of Marseille, France.
After many years of captivity, Dantès finally escapes and discovers a hidden treasure, making him one of the wealthiest men in the world. Assuming the identity of the Count of Monte Cristo, he sets out to take revenge on those who wrongly accused him. The series also features Jeremy Irons as Abbé Faria, a fellow prisoner who shares the whereabouts of the treasure with Dantès.
Following the streaming premiere, a weekly broadcast of the series will begin on March 22 at 10/9c. The Count of Monte Cristo is produced by Palomar and DEMD Productions, two Mediawan companies, and distributed worldwide by MediawanRights in cooperation with CAA (for North America) and with the participation of Entourage Ventures.
